677 W Covington Ave, Attalla, AL 35954
226.9 miles away from Fairford, Alabama
108 Ophelia Ln, Lafayette, LA 70506
245.7 miles away from Fairford, Alabama
414 E Tuscaloosa St, Florence, AL 35630
252.2 miles away from Fairford, Alabama
122 Helton Ct, Florence, AL 35630
254.2 miles away from Fairford, Alabama
308 Vernon St, West Monroe, LA 71291
256.2 miles away from Fairford, Alabama